#navbar {
    position: fixed;
    display: grid;
    grid-template-columns: auto 1fr auto;
    width: 100vw;
    z-index: 100;
    overflow: hidden;
    background-color: var(--soft-gray);
    filter: drop-shadow(0px 10px 3px var(--shadow));
    top: 0;
}
#navbar ul {
    grid-column: 2;
    justify-self: center;
    align-self: center;
    list-style: none;
    padding: 0;
    margin: 0;
}
#navbar li {
    display: inline-block;
}
#navbar li > a {
    display: block;
    color: var(--soft-white);
    text-align: center;
    text-decoration: none;
    font-weight: bold;
    padding: 1rem;
}
.content {
    margin-top: 5rem;
}
.search {
    display: block;
    grid-column: 1;
    justify-self: center;
    align-self: center;
    margin-left: 2rem;
}
.github-mark {
    display: block;
    grid-column: 3;
    justify-self: center;
    align-self: center;
    margin-right: 2rem;
}
